Output 68b659ceb3266faf00dc49915e53833801df421a6bc5b81cd51c0a92f242e343:3

value
998317
script pubkey
OP_0 OP_PUSHBYTES_20 f0c5e9c59997950a2d625588aadcc8af36d4cfc1
address
ltc1q7rz7n3vej72s5ttz2ky24hxg4umdfn7pwj0vpg
transaction
68b659ceb3266faf00dc49915e53833801df421a6bc5b81cd51c0a92f242e343
spent
true